What To Expect

Five Steps From Emergency Call to Dry Property

We keep the process simple and predictable, even when the situation at your Garrett property feels anything but.

1

Contact Our Garrett Dispatch

Our dispatcher gathers the basics — location, type of water, affected areas — and gets a technician moving right away.

2

Technician On-Site

Our Garrett crew shows up in a marked vehicle, walks the property, and identifies every affected area before touching equipment.

3

Water Removal Starts

We remove standing water first, then move to saturated materials like carpet pad, drywall, and subfloor.

4

Dehumidification & Monitoring

Air movers and dehumidifiers are placed strategically, and moisture levels are checked daily until the structure reads dry.

5

Repairs & Sign-Off

Once dry, any needed repairs or reconstruction begin, and we walk the Garrett property with you before closing the job.

Insurance Support Throughout

Every step is photographed and logged, so your insurance claim has the documentation it needs from day one.

Our Equipment

Commercial-Grade Equipment, Not Rental-Store Fans

Every Garrett vehicle in our fleet is stocked with commercial extraction pumps, industrial dehumidifiers, air movers, and thermal imaging cameras — the same tools used on large-scale commercial losses, scaled down for residential jobs.

That equipment difference matters. A rental-store fan moves air across a surface; our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of the air and out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days in most Garrett jobs.

Beyond the Shop Vac

Why Professional Commercial Water Damage Restoration Beats DIY Cleanup in Garrett

A shop vac and a few fans can make a Garrett property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two very different things.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Garrett hom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Garrett techn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Garrett property.
